Forensic Context

A study in human embryonic stem cells demonstrated that the circBIRC6 controls pluripotency by sequestering miR-34 and miR-145 [Patop et al. DOI:10.15252/embj.2018100836], and it acts as a sponge for miR-34a and miR-145 to relieve the suppression of NANOG, OCT4, and SOX2 expression [Di Agostino et al. DOI:10.3389/fcell.2020.00389]. A study in humans demonstrated that the BIRC6 gene can generate hundreds of circRNA isoforms, and their expression changes during tumorigenesis can differ [Li et al. DOI:10.1093/bib/bby006].
